Vipreet Raja Yoga

Vipreet Raja Yoga is a special yoga in astrology that operates on the principle of transformation through hardship. Words "Vipreet" indicates reversed, and "Raja Yoga" indicates a kingly mix. Hence, Vipreet Raja Yoga stands for a paradoxical scenario where difficult circumstances or challenges actually lead to desirable results. This yoga is created when the lords of the 6th, 8th, or 12th residences are put in their very own or each other's homes, symbolizing that battle or misery may ultimately bring about success, fame, or prosperity.

This yoga is specifically effective for people that deal with obstacles early in life but rise to success via their endurance and capacity to get over difficulties. Vipreet Raja Yoga typically brings unforeseen opportunities, also in the midst of challenges, enabling the native to achieve substantial success. Those with this yoga in their horoscope commonly discover that their resilience and ability to browse complicated situations bring about excellent achievements.

Gaja Kesari Yoga

Gaja Kesari Yoga is one more significant yoga in Vedic astrology, understood for bestowing power, knowledge, and wealth upon the indigenous. The term "Gaja" means elephant, and "Kesari" describes a lion, symbolizing stamina and knowledge. This yoga happens when Jupiter remains in conjunction with or in a positive aspect with the Moon, commonly leading to a life of success, acknowledgment, and influence.

People blessed with Gaja Kesari Yoga are typically solid, smart, and significant figures in their communities. They have a tendency to have fantastic management qualities and are understood for their intellectual expertise and noble character. This yoga additionally brings security and lasting success, particularly in locations related to riches, online reputation, and power.

Neecha Banga Yoga

Neecha Banga Yoga is a special yoga that can squash the negative impacts of a disabled earth in a horoscope. The term "Neecha" means disabled, and "Banga" indicates termination. This yoga forms when an incapacitated world is related to a benefic earth or when the lord of the house where the incapacitated world is put is solid. When this yoga exists, the citizen may initially experience problems, however those difficulties will certainly be alleviated with time, often leading to fantastic success later in life.

Neecha Banga Yoga is especially essential in charts where the local has a run-down world, as it suggests that the unfavorable impacts of that world will be balanced out by other positive worldly influences. Individuals with this yoga may go through struggles but eventually arise more powerful, better, and extra effective.

Dhana Yoga

Dhana Yoga, or the yoga of riches, is developed when worlds in particular homes related to wealth, such as the 2nd, 5th, 9th, or 11th houses, remain in solid settings. This yoga is connected with monetary prosperity, often leading the belonging to build up wealth and resources with time. The toughness and positioning of these worlds identify the amount of wide range the local can expect in their lifetime.

Those with Dhana Yoga in their graph are commonly economically savvy, able to make sound financial investments, and gain from different opportunities connected to riches accumulation. This yoga can additionally bring riches through inheritance or unanticipated monetary gains.

Daridra Yoga

As opposed to Dhana Yoga, Daridra Yoga signifies destitution or monetary battles. This yoga is developed when malefic earths, particularly those associated with the 6th, 8th, or 12th homes, are badly placed in the chart. People with Daridra Yoga in their horoscope might face economic difficulties, financial debts, or has a hard time to maintain monetary stability.

Nevertheless, like all yogas, Daridra Yoga does not figure out fate. With correct planning, self-control, and remedial procedures, individuals can overcome their financial difficulties and boost their circumstance.

Ishta Devata

In Vedic astrology, the principle of Ishta Devata refers to one's individual deity or assisting spiritual pressure. Based on the global positions in an individual's horoscope, an astrologist can identify the citizen's Ishta Devata, the deity that will supply them the greatest spiritual support and guidance throughout life. Venerating the Ishta Devata can aid the individual gotten rid of obstacles, achieve comfort, and attach more deeply with their spiritual function.

The Ishta Devata is commonly identified with an evaluation of the 12th residence in a person's chart, in addition to various other important worldly impacts. Getting in touch with this personal deity can bring terrific self-confidence and consistency, helping the native accomplish equilibrium and gratification.
